Erik grew up in the ultra-conservative town of Lodi, a small town with small town ideals and values that is located near Sacramento.
At a young age he worked as a delivery person at the Lodi Flower shop, his creative talents were soon noticed and he soon worked his way up to head designer. This also put Erik in contact with a wide variety of people, and Erik discovered that he also had a natural affinity to heal people. This led him to the study and practice of Reiki. Erik developed a knack for channeling healing energy and was very effective in helping people cope with difficult life situations, often making them pendants, bracelets, earrings and other such items with therapeutic potential. As his reputation and his clientele grew Erik realized that Lodi was too small for him and he decided to move to "the city" -- San Francisco!
Bursting with creative energy he decided to enroll in the fashion design program at FIDM and graduated in 1999 after 2 years of hard work.
Working as an independent artist, he started making pillows, pillow shams and duvet covers as well as making his own personal clothes.
By this time people were already asking him if he would make clothes for them, but Erik felt he was not yet ready. It was 2002 when he finally agreed to make a hat for a friend. Of course, this led to more hats and then other items for the same friend and then his friends, and then their friends.
Soon Erik was making costumes for dancers, drag queens,
Burning Man folks and a couple of well-known prostitutes. He then started
experimenting with what he calls "clothing reconstruction" where he takes
existing garments, either new or old, and combines them with custom design
elements to create new "one of a kind" clothing items. The first pair of pants
that he reconstructed was a composite of two pairs of men's old work pants that
he combined together. This item was literally purchased of off his body when he
wore them out one day. Ever since that experience in 2001, Erik has been honing
his reconstruction technique and style.
Erik's line of clothing is called "5 Earth Star" after his Feng Shui personality
type based on his birthday. Erik has a list of clients that he designs "one of a
kind" clothing items for and feels that he is now ready for the wider world, and
